How to waterproof your boots


Waterproofing your boots is one of the best things you can do to take care of them, from fashion boots, hiking boots, motorcycle boots, etc. But how do you go about it?

When purchasing the boots in-store:

  • Ask the salesclerk what he or she recommends for you as waterproofing products. There are many kinds of products, including oil, wax, silicone, and water-base. Asking the clerk would give you an idea of which kind of products would work for your boot material.
  • Ask the clerk for specific technique to waterproof your boots. Make sure you ask them in detail, such ask whether you should rub the product in, or wait for it to be obsorbed, or just let it air dry.
  • Ask the clerk for the possible side effects the products will cause on your boots, and consider whether you would go for waterproofing them or not.

When purchasing the boots online:

  • Contact the manufacturer (via email, toll-free number, or live-chat, etc.) for answers regard the same questions mentioned above.

Tips:

  • It is recommended that you waterproof your boots before you start wearing them, even if you have purchased a pair of waterproof boots.
  • Don’t forget to get ample the products into the seam area where the sole meets the boot, then work the product into the seam area using a q-tip or a toothbrush.
  • Don’t use rough device when you waterproof your boots as you might damage them.
  • Each time you clean your boots, reapply the waterproof products to maintain your boots condition.

Drying your boots properly

When you forget to waterproof your boots and they get wet, dry them properly to avoid damaging.

  • Wipe off dirt and mug
  • Air dry them in well-circulated indoor area (Don’t leave them in the sun to dry! Don’t use a hair dryer! Don’t use a heater!)
  • Use foot powder or baking soda if they smell after drying
  • Waterproof them so you don’t have to do this again ;)
